KZN IVG Club Farmers’ Day – 28 September 2017

On Saturday 28 September the KZN Club held their third farmers day and sixth event for the year 2017.

It was a resounding success with a total of 43 people (37 members and 6 non-members [all of whom have

filled in application forms to join the Club!]) attending along with 6 goat-mad children!

Attendees came from as far afield as Central Zululand, Northern Natal, KZN South Coast, as well as from all

over the KZN Midlands.

The two main topics were:

A) The Selecting of Productive Ewes. This was both a lecture with notes provided and a hands-on

demonstration amongst 60 ewes and 3 rams held in pens (kindly supplied by AAM Auctioneers for the

day).

B) Record Keeping as a management tool.

The above topics were presented by Hilton Sanders; the two topics go hand-in-hand as one must not only

rely on a visual appraisal of one’s ewes but cross reference with accurate records in order to increase one’s

productivity in any given flock.

IVG Ekotipes / Eco-types

Nguni

Die Nguni-tipe bokke is waarskynlik die eko-groep

wat die mees geredelikste voorkom in suidelike

Afrika.

Hulle kom spesifiek voor in die hoër reenvalstreke,

naamlik vanaf die Ciskei, Transkei, Kwa-Zulu Natal,

Swaziland, Mpumalanga, Noordelike Provinsie,

Botswana, die Caprivi, en die mees noordelike,

hoë-reënvalstreek van Namibië.

By nadere ondersoek van hierdie tipe inheemse

bokke in die genoemde areas, is dit duidelik dat

hulle tot dieselfde fenotipe behoort, met klein

geografiese variasies.

Kenmerkende Karakter-eienskappe:

Die ore van die Nguni-tipe bok is klein tot medium

en semi-hangend.

Hulle is medium- tot kleinraam bokke, maar

proporsioneel goed gebalanseerd.

Seksuele demorfisme is kenmerkend van hierdie

ekotipe – d.i. klein vroulike diere met heelwat

groter manlike diere.

Die profiel van die gesig neig om effens konkaaf

(holvormig) tot plat te wees, alhoewel sommige

ramme geneig is tot ‘n effense romeinse neus.

Die bek is hoofsaaklik donker gepigmenteerd. Die

skakering van donkerheid kan varieer.

Die ore is klein tot medium in groote, met ‘n

laterale (sydelings na buite) en effense vorentoe

oriëntasie, sommige is semi-hangend – eers in ‘n

laterale rigting en begin dan hang.

Horings is by albei geslagte aanwesig. Natuurlike

horinglose bokke kom soms voor, maar is skaars.

Nguni

The Nguni type is probably the group that occurs

more abundantly than the other distinct types of

indigenous goats, in southern Africa.

They occur specifically in the higher rainfall areas

stretching from the Ciskei, Transkei, Kwa-Zulu

Natal, Swaziland, Mpumalanga, Northern

Province, Botswana, the Caprivi, and extreme

northern, high rainfall area of Namibia.

Upon closer investigation of these type of

indigenous goats in the abovementioned areas it

is clear that they belong to the same phenotype,

with rather small geographic variations.

Distinctive Characteristics:

The ears of the Nguni-type goat are small to

medium and semi-pendulous.

They are medium to small frame, well

proportioned goats.

Sexual demorfism is a characteristic of the eco-

type – i.e. small females with much larger males.

The profile of the face tends to be flat or slightly

concave (hollow), although some males exhibit a

slight roman nose.

The muzzle is predominantly dark pigmented.

Shade of darkness may vary.

The ears are small to medium in size and have a

lateral (sidelong and outwards) and slightly

forward orientation, some are semi-droopy – first

pointing lateral and then starts to droop.

Horns are present in both sexes. Naturally polled

animals are sometimes found in the breed, but are

rare in most areas.

By ooie groei die horings opwaarts en draai

uitwaarts, maar baie variasies kan voorkom. By

ramme is die horings meer geneig om agteroor en

uitwaarts te draai. By ooie is die horings korter en

kleiner, en by die ramme is dit ‘n medium lengte

en swaarder.

Belletjies kom voor by ‘n persentasie van manlike-

en vroulike diere.

Baarde is nogal algemeen by hierdie eko-tipe, en

kom voor by albei geslagte; kleiner by ooie en

groter by ramme waar dit in die langer hare van

die nek invloei.

Die nek is slank by ooie en goed aangeheg aan die

skouers. Ramme het dikker, goed gespierde nekke

en skouers wat met langer hare bedek is.

Die voor-arm is fyner by ooie, en swaarder by

ramme. Ooie het ‘n fyner beenstruktuur in

vergelyking met die swaarder beenstruktuur van

die ramme.

Die ekotipe het goeie lengte- en diepte van lyf. Die

rug neig om effens hol te wees

Ooie, en soms ook van die ramme, is nie baie

gespierd nie. In goeie gehalte ramme is die

agterkwart gespierd aan die binne- en buitekante

van die dye.

Die ekotipe het ‘n normale hangkruis.

Die stert is kort tot medium, regop, met ‘n dun

basis.

Beide geslagte het sterk, maar fyn, en medium tot

lang bene. Hoewe is hoofsaaklik donker-kleurig.

Soms kan ligter kleure en gestreepte hoewe

voorkom.

In females the horns grow upwards and curve

outwards, although many variations occur. In

males the horns are more inclined to curve

backwards and outwards. In females the horns are

short and lighter, and in males of medium length

and heavier.

Toggles are present in a percentage of male and

female animals.

Beards are rather general among this eco-type,

present in both sexes; small in females and large

in the case of males where it flows into the longer

hair of the neck.

The neck is slender in females and well attached to

the shoulders. Males have thicker, well-muscled

necks and shoulders covered with long hair.

The fore-arm is slender in the females and heavier

in the males. The females have a fine bone

structure in comparison to the heavier bone

structure of the males.

The ecotype has good length and depth of body.

The back tends to be slightly hollow.

The females and some of the males are not well-

muscled. In good quality males the hind quarters

are well-muscled on the inner and outer thighs.

The ecotype has a sloping rump.

The tail is short to medium, erect, with a thin base.

Both sexes have strong, but fine, and medium to

long legs. Hooves are predominantly dark in

colour. Occasionally lighter colour and striped

hooves occur.

Die Nguni ekotipe is veelkleurig, met ‘n wye

verskeidenheid van eenvormige kleure, wit, swart,

beige, bruin en rooi-bruin, bont, appelkleurig en

gespikkled, en allerhande kombinasies hiervan,

met ‘n neiging tot “swiss” merke in die gesig.

Die meeste bokke het ‘n kort, glansende

haarbedekking, en sommige bokke is geneig om

kasjmier in die koue winters te groei. Sommige

individue het langer hare aan die onderkant van

die lyf en agterkwart.

The Nguni eco-type is multi coloured, with a wide

variety of uniform colours, white, black, fawn,

brown and red-brown, pied, dappled and

speckled, and all combinations of these colours,

with a tendency towards swiss-markings in the

face.

Most goats have a short, glossy hair coat, and

some goats are inclined to grow cashmere in cold

winters. Individuals with longer hair on the lower

body and hind quarters are sometimes found.
